Sir Clive Woodward on why he thinks James Haskell has been dropped by England

There were plenty of talking points from the Northampton-Wasps match on Saturday, and former England coach Sir Clive Woodward used the match as the perfect opportunity to watch James Haskell.

The back-rower, who was left out of England’s squad for the Autumn Internationals, was once again struggling to recapture his best form despite his sides unexpected victory.

And Woodward, who has been a big fan of the flanker in the past, thinks he has pinpointed the problem.

‘Despite a fine Wasps performance, James Haskell is not quite himself and you can see why Eddie Jones has not included him in the England squad,’ wrote Woodward.

‘He looks too muscular and heavy to me and is not making the impact he has in recent seasons.
